    FCCU GNU/Linux Forensic Boot CD description

    FCCU GNU/Linux Forensic Bootable CD is a bootable CD based on KNOPPIX.

    FCCU GNU/Linux Forensic Bootable CD is a bootable CD based on KNOPPIX that contains a lot of tools suitable for computer forensic investigatins, including bash scripts.

    FCCU GNU/Linux Forensic Boot CD's main purpose is to create images of devices prior to analysis, and it is used by the Belgian Federal Computer Crime Unit.

    Here are some key features of "FCCU GNU/Linux Forensic Boot CD":

    · This CD is based on KNOPPIX by Klauss Knopper.
    · It is a remaster that I made to use at my work as a computer forensic investigator.
    · Its main purpose is to create images copies of devices before analyse.
    · It does not use a lot of cpu cycles for unnecessary programs, that is why it drops you to a shell right after the boot.
    · It recognizes lots of hardware (Thanks to Klauss Knopper).
    · It leaves the target devices unaltered (It does not use the swap partitions found on the devices).
    · It contains a lot of tools with forensic purpose.

    What's New in This Release: [ read full changelog ]

    · The ability to start in non-graphical mode by passing "live 3" as a boot parameter.
    · An updated version of Guymager (0.3.1).
    · Two Windows tools to copy Win32 memory (including Vista): win32dd and mantech mdd.
    · The memory analysis tool Volatility was added.
    · The registry analysis tool regripper was added. aeskeyfinder and rsakeyfinder were added.
    · A better starting Web page and a better description of the tools on the CD.
    · An updated version (0.40) of the Perl library Parse-win32Registry.
    · Version 3.3.4 of afflib.
